Pyrromethene class of compounds and its derivatives are used in various fields such as sensors, lasers and medicinal chemistry. The preparation of Pyrromethene 546 which is a well known laser dye involves usage of harsh conditions and special precautions for carrying out the reaction taking 2,4 dimethyl pyrrole as a reactant which is prepared from ethyl acetoacetate in three steps. We have prepared Pyrromethene 546 in a single pot reaction using 2,4-dimethyl pyrrole, acetyl chloride and boron trifluoride under milder conditions. Pyrromethene 546 was subjected to various electrophilic substitution reactions such as, acetylation and nitration to give acetyl and nitro derivatives. The products were characterized and properties studied.
